Hmm, do we need try-poll as per-direction option? If not we could
simplify AudiodevAlsaOptions this way ...
{ 'struct': 'AudiodevAlsaOptions',
'data': {
'*dev-in': 'str',
'*dev-out': 'str',
'*threshold': 'uint32'
'*try-poll': 'bool' } }
... eliminating some nesting.

AudiodevPaPerDirectionOptions has only the name field, so we can drop
the struct and just use '*sink' : 'str' ...
